Title: The Innovations of Susumu Enjoji
Introduction
Susumu Enjoji, an accomplished inventor based in Ootawara, Japan, is renowned for his contributions to the field of ultrasonic technology. With a total of nine patents to his name, Enjoji's inventive spirit has significantly advanced the way ultrasonic diagnostic and scanning apparatuses are designed and utilized.
Latest Patents
Among Enjoji's latest innovations are two notable patents. The first is an **Ultrasonic Diagnostic Apparatus**, which features a transmit/receive circuit equipped with multiple channels, allowing for efficient signal processing from ultrasonic oscillation elements. This apparatus aids in providing accurate diagnostic information from subjects by enabling parallel connections of both transmit and receive channels.
The second patent is for a **Mechanical Type Ultrasonic Scanner**. This scanner comprises a specialized housing filled with an acoustic liquid medium, designed to facilitate the generation and scanning of ultrasonic waves. A unique partition wall within the housing not only maintains the separation of the liquid medium chambers but also effectively channels bubbles that may disrupt the scanning process. These innovations reflect Enjoji’s commitment to enhancing ultrasonic imaging and diagnostics.
Career Highlights
Susumu Enjoji has had a notable career, having worked with significant companies such as Tokyo Shibaura Denki and Toshiba Corporation. His experiences at these leading firms have undoubtedly played a crucial role in shaping his expertise and innovative capabilities in the field of ultrasound technology.
Collaborations
Throughout his career, Enjoji has collaborated with talented individuals, including colleagues like Koji Saito and Yushichi Kikuchi. These collaborations have not only contributed to his projects but have also enriched the developmental processes of the patents he has secured.
